Brown aluminum oxide abrasive is widely used in components of reaction vessels, pipelines and chemical pumps due to its high hardness, high strength and good wear resistance; it is used as mechanical parts and various grinding tools in the mechanical industry. Wire drawing dies, pencil core mold extrusion nozzles, etc.; making tools, bulletproof materials, mold abrasives, human joints and sealing mold rings.
Brown fused alumina abrasives as thermal insulation materials, such as corundum hollow balls, fiber products and corundum lightweight bricks, have been widely used in the top and wall of high-temperature furnaces, which are not only resistant to high temperatures, but also heat-insulating.
Brown aluminum oxide abrasives due to its high temperature resistance, corrosion resistance, high strength and other properties, sliding nozzles are used to process precious metals, special alloys, ceramics and iron blast furnace linings (walls and tubes), physical and chemical containers, spark plugs, heat-resistant and anti-oxidation coatings, etc.
In terms of color, it is best to distinguish the color of brown molten alumina. It is usually dark purple and purple. Under sunlight, the transparency is high.
It is translucent and shiny, and this brown fused alumina usually has a slightly higher hardness and better wear resistance. High in iron and high in content.
The larger the brown fused alumina particles, the darker the color. Generally, brown aluminum oxide abrasives have good self-sharpening and good toughness. The less material that is strongly magnetically absorbed, the better the quality. The grade and quality of brown corundum abrasives can be identified from the color.
To distinguish the shape and size, good brown aluminum oxide depends on its original mineral quality. Generally, good main minerals are mainly spherical small particles with small particle size, strong impact resistance and smooth and shiny surface.
There are three grades of brown aluminum oxide to distinguish from the content of alumina, and the quality of the first to third grades gradually weakens. The quality of brown corundum mainly depends on the content of AL2O3. The grade of brown fused alumina is AL2O3 content greater than 95%, so it is often called 95th brown fused alumina. The AL2O3 content of the second and third grade brown fused alumina gradually decreases, and the quality also decreases. The larger the brown fused alumina particles, the darker the color.
